Troubleshooting Steps

Here’s a structured approach to resolving Face ID problems on iOS 26:

1. Basic Checks

  • Clean the TrueDepth Camera: Use a soft, lint-free cloth to gently clean the front-facing camera area.
  • Remove Obstructions: Ensure no screen protectors or cases are blocking the camera or sensors.
  • Restart Your iPhone: A simple restart can often resolve temporary software glitches.

2. Verify Face ID Settings

  • Check Face ID is Enabled: Go to Settings "> Face ID & Passcode and ensure Face ID is turned on for iPhone Unlock and other relevant options.
  • Reset Face ID: If Face ID is enabled but not working, tap Reset Face ID and set it up again. This can help if your facial data was corrupted during the update.

3. Software Solutions

  • Update to the Latest iOS Version: Apple often releases updates to fix bugs. Go to Settings "> General "> Software Update to check for and install any available updates.
  • Reset All Settings: This will revert all settings to their default values without erasing your data. Go to Settings "> General "> Transfer or Reset iPhone "> Reset "> Reset All Settings.

4. Advanced Troubleshooting

  • Check for Hardware Issues: Use the Apple Support app to run diagnostics on your device. This can help identify any hardware malfunctions.
  • Restore Your iPhone: As a last resort, restore your iPhone to factory settings. Ensure you back up your data first. Go to Settings "> General "> Transfer or Reset iPhone "> Erase All Content and Settings.
